Claims
- 1. A wood processing element for reducing the size of a wood member passing across a separating grate defining a filtering slot, said separating grate having a first and a second side, said filtering slot including a leading and a trailing edge, comprising:
- means defining at least one cutting edge for engaging said wood member such that a portion is removed therefrom, said means extending from said trailing edge of said slot;
- means extending from said cutting edge for directing said wood portion into said slot; and
- means for attaching said wood processing element to said separating grate.
- 2.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 1, further comprising means defining a second cutting edge, said means extending from said trailing edge of said slot.
- 3. A wood processing element for reducing the size of a wood member passing across a separating grate defining a filtering slot, comprising:
- means defining at least one cutting edge for engaging said wood member such that a portion is removed therefrom;
- means defining at least one breakup ledge; and
- means for attaching said wood processing element to said separating grate wherein said breakup ledge is positioned relative to said slot and said breakup ledge interferes with said wood portion as said portion passes through said filtering slot.
- 4.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 3, further comprising means defining a second cutting edge, said means extending from said trailing edge of said slot.
- 5.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 1, wherein said cutting edge is spaced apart from said first side of said grate such that said cutting edge engages said wood member prior to entry of said wood portion into said filtering slot.
- 6.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 1, wherein said means defining at least one cutting edge extending from said trailing edge of said slot is a wedge-shaped knife inserted into said slot and wherein said means for directing said wood portion is a leading face defined by said wedge-shaped knife, said leading face being inclined downwardly into said slot.
- 7. The wood processing machine of claim 6, wherein said means for attaching said element to said grate is by weldments.
- 8.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 3, wherein said cutting edge is spaced above said first side of said grate such that said cutting edge engages said wood member prior to entry of said wood portion into said filtering slot.
- 9.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 8, wherein said means defining at least one cutting edge extending from said trailing edge of said slot is a wedge-shaped knife inserted into said slot.
- 10. The wood processing element of claim 9, wherein said means for attaching said element to said grate is by weldments.
- 11. The wood processing element as claimed in claim 1, wherein said slot of said separating grate includes a trailing wall, said wood processing element further including a ledge extending into said slot and away from said trailing wall for engaging said wood portion such that said wood portion engages said ledge and is further reduced by breakage.
